And before becoming self-employed?
I was Director of Marketing at Steady and Makerist. I trained as a yoga teacher in India. I was a journalist in training at Cosmopolitan. I launched my own DIY magazine (20,000 copies). I spoke on television. I was named one of the 30 under 30 in the communications industry. I served on the jury for the PR Bild Award . I steeled my nerves. And I learned how to lead with a focus on needs.
